Implementation steps
-
Choose the starting event and owner
Decide which application acts when goods are ready for the agreed shipment notification. Name the operational owner of the despatch advice and the team that resolves rejected or ambiguous messages.
-
Keep record IDs connected
Map shipment, order, packaging and item identifiers. Confirm qualifiers, code lists, units and date/time meaning against the agreed EDIFACT version and Amazon guide. Preserve the source reference alongside any new destination identifier.
-
Test failures before launch
Run the failure cases in the mapping table against realistic despatch advice data. Check how the receiving system reports a rejection and how your team corrects it without creating a duplicate.
-
Track every document to completion
Record transport delivery and document validation separately from successful despatch advice processing. Give unresolved errors an owner and check the receiving system before approving retries.
Go-live checklist
- An approved DESADV sample and the agreed version and partner guide are available.
- The mapping tests pass with realistic despatch advice data.
- Each submitted document can be traced through delivery, validation and processing in the receiving system.
- Your team knows how to investigate and recover a rejected or timed-out despatch advice without processing it twice.

What should I map for EDIFACT DESADV?
Start with shipment, order, packaging and item identifiers and the target despatch advice. Define duplicate detection, allowed updates and response correlation before mapping individual fields. Use the partner guide to check required fields and their formats.
How should I test DESADV error handling?
Reconcile nested packages to dispatched item quantities. Keep separate despatches against one order as separate shipment records. Also test a lost response after destination processing so that a retry cannot create an unintended duplicate or repeated adjustment.
